History and Legacy
The Slovenský klub chovateľov teriérov a foxteriérov (SKCHTaF) stands as a cornerstone of canine preservation in Slovakia, dedicated to the stewardship of various terrier breeds. Since its inception, the organization has served as the primary authority for enthusiasts and breeders committed to maintaining the integrity of these spirited dogs. The club was established to provide a structured environment for the development of the Fox Terrier FCI standard 12, ensuring that the historical working capabilities and physical characteristics of the breed remain consistent with international standards.
Over the decades, the club has cultivated a deep-rooted legacy by fostering a community of dedicated individuals who prioritize the long-term health and functional excellence of their dogs. By acting as a central hub for information and coordination, the organization has successfully navigated the complexities of modern breeding, ensuring that the rich heritage of these animals is preserved for future generations of owners and handlers alike.
Mission and Core Values
The mission of the SKCHTaF is centered on the ethical advancement of terrier breeds, with a primary focus on health, temperament, and adherence to established breed standards. The club mandates that all breeding practices prioritize the physical well-being of the animals, requiring rigorous health screenings to mitigate hereditary conditions. By promoting transparency in pedigree documentation, the club ensures that every litter is produced with the utmost care and responsibility.
Integrity remains the guiding principle for all members. The organization emphasizes the importance of ethical conduct, encouraging breeders to maintain high standards of animal welfare. This commitment extends to the careful selection of bloodlines, which are monitored to ensure that the unique traits of the terrier group are not only preserved but also protected from the risks associated with indiscriminate breeding practices.
Club Activities and Breed Focus
The SKCHTaF plays a vital role in the organization of various shows, which serve as essential platforms for evaluating the conformation and movement of the dogs. These events are not merely competitive; they are critical opportunities for breeders to receive constructive feedback from qualified experts who specialize in the nuances of the terrier group. Through these gatherings, the club maintains a high level of quality control across the national population.
Beyond the ring, the club is deeply involved in working trials and field activities that test the natural instincts of the dogs. These competitions are designed to honor the working history of the breed, ensuring that they retain the intelligence and drive for which they are renowned. The club also facilitates access to specialized education, where owners can learn about proper handling, grooming, and the specific behavioral needs of their companions.
